Gibson's take on the life of Scottish hero, William Wallace, has many historical inaccuracies.

Scots did not start wearing tartan for another 300 years. The Scots never painted their faces for battle. The Picts, another people group who inhabited Scotland before assimilating into the Scots and Celts, did. The film also leaves out one of Wallace's most famous victories, the Battle of Stirling Bridge.

Otherwise, this is a well made film that men will especially enjoy.
